Spray booths are essential equipment in various industries for applying coatings such as paint, varnish, or powder to products. The choice between manual and automated spray booths significantly affects production efficiency, finish quality, and operational costs. While automated spray booths are favored for high-volume, consistent output, several industries still prefer manual spray booths due to their unique advantages. This article explores the top industries that favor manual spray booths over automated systems, explaining the reasons behind their preference and the specific benefits manual booths offer.

Understanding Manual Spray Booths

Manual spray booths involve human operators who apply coatings using spray guns by hand. This method requires skilled labor to control the spray pattern, thickness, and finish quality. The flexibility and precision of manual spraying make it ideal for certain applications where customization and detail are critical.

Advantages of Manual Spray Booths

- Precision and Control: Operators can adjust the spray in real-time, allowing for intricate detailing and customized finishes.

- Flexibility: Suitable for small batches and diverse product types with varying coating requirements.

- Lower Initial Investment: Manual booths generally cost less to set up compared to automated systems.

- Adaptability: Easily adjusted for different product sizes and shapes without extensive reprogramming or tooling changes.

Challenges of Manual Spray Booths

- Labor Intensive: Requires skilled workers and more time per unit.

- Inconsistency Risks: Variability in operator skill can lead to inconsistent finishes.

- Higher Labor Costs: Skilled labor demands higher wages and training.

Industries That Prefer Manual Spray Booths

Automotive Restoration and Customization

In automotive restoration and customization shops, manual spray booths are preferred due to the need for detailed, bespoke paint jobs. Classic cars, custom paint designs, and one-off parts require the nuanced touch that only a skilled painter can provide. Automated systems, while efficient, may struggle with the complexity and variability of these projects.

- Precision Detailing: Manual spraying allows for fine control over paint application, essential for matching original finishes or creating unique designs.

- Small Batch Production: Restoration projects are typically low volume, making automation less cost-effective.

- Flexibility: Ability to switch between different paint types and colors quickly without reprogramming.

Aerospace Industry (Specialized Components)

Certain aerospace components require coatings that must meet stringent quality and safety standards. Manual spray booths are often used for parts that are complex in shape or require specialized coatings applied in small quantities.

- Complex Geometries: Manual spraying can better reach intricate areas that automated nozzles might miss.

- High-Quality Finish: Skilled operators ensure coatings meet exact specifications.

- Low Volume, High Value: Aerospace parts are often produced in low volumes but require exceptional quality.

Furniture and Woodworking

Custom furniture manufacturers and woodworking shops often use manual spray booths to apply stains, lacquers, and paints. The artistic nature of furniture finishing demands flexibility and precision that automated systems may not offer.

- Varied Finishes: Different wood types and finishes require tailored application techniques.

- Small to Medium Batches: Production runs are often limited, making manual booths more economical.

- Artisan Quality: Manual application supports the craftsmanship valued in high-end furniture.

Artistic and Decorative Coatings

Industries producing decorative items, art pieces, or specialty coatings prefer manual spray booths for their ability to handle unique finishes and small production runs.

- Customization: Each piece may require a different technique or color.

- Intricate Designs: Manual spraying supports detailed work and layering effects.

- Low Volume: Artistic products are rarely mass-produced.

Prototype and R&D Facilities

Research and development departments and prototype manufacturers favor manual spray booths because of the need for flexibility and experimentation.

- Rapid Changes: Manual spraying allows quick adjustments without reprogramming machinery.

- Small Quantities: Prototypes are produced in limited numbers.

- Testing Different Coatings: Manual booths facilitate trials with various materials and techniques.

Why These Industries Choose Manual Over Automated Spray Booths

Flexibility and Customization

Manual spray booths allow operators to adapt to different shapes, sizes, and coating types easily. Automated systems require programming and tooling changes that can be costly and time-consuming for small or varied runs.

Cost Considerations

For industries with low production volumes or high variability, the upfront investment in automated spray booths is often unjustifiable. Manual booths offer a more affordable solution without sacrificing quality for specialized applications.

Skill and Artistic Value

Some industries value the human touch and craftsmanship that manual spraying provides. This is particularly true in restoration, artistic, and high-end furniture sectors where finish quality and uniqueness are paramount.

Handling Complex and Irregular Shapes

Manual spraying can better accommodate irregular or complex shapes that automated nozzles cannot easily cover, ensuring complete and even coating.

Comparing Manual and Automated Spray Booths

Feature Manual Spray Booths Automated Spray Booths
Initial Cost Lower Higher
Labor Requirement High (skilled operators needed) Low (operators oversee machines)
Flexibility High (easy to switch products and finishes) Low (requires reprogramming for changes)
Volume Suitability Low to medium High volume
Consistency Variable (depends on operator skill) High (machine-controlled application)
Precision and Detail High (operator control) Moderate (programmed patterns)
Maintenance Lower (less complex equipment) Higher (complex machinery and software)

Conclusion

Manual spray booths remain essential in industries where customization, precision, and flexibility are critical. Automotive restoration, aerospace specialized components, furniture finishing, artistic coatings, and prototype development are prime examples where manual spraying outperforms automated systems. While automation excels in high-volume, repetitive tasks, manual spray booths provide the adaptability and control necessary for specialized, low-volume, or highly detailed applications.

Related Questions and Answers

Q1: What are the main benefits of manual spray booths compared to automated ones?

A1: Manual spray booths offer greater flexibility, precision, and adaptability for small batch and customized jobs, while automated booths excel in consistency and high-volume production.

Q2: Which industries benefit most from automated spray booths?

A2: Industries with large-scale, repetitive production such as automotive manufacturing, electronics, and fashion accessories benefit most from automated spray booths due to their efficiency and consistency.

Q3: Are manual spray booths more expensive to operate than automated ones?

A3: Manual spray booths typically have lower initial costs but higher labor costs due to the need for skilled operators, whereas automated booths have higher upfront costs but lower ongoing labor expenses.

Q4: Can manual spray booths achieve the same finish quality as automated booths?

A4: Yes, manual spray booths can achieve high-quality finishes, especially when operated by skilled workers, and are preferred for intricate or customized finishes.

Q5: What factors should a business consider when choosing between manual and automated spray booths?

A5: Businesses should consider production volume, product complexity, budget, desired finish quality, labor availability, and flexibility needs when choosing between manual and automated spray booths.
